About Blake Field
Blake Field (KAJZ) is located in Delta, US at an elevation of 5,193 feet MSL, making density altitude a consideration for performance planning. The airport has 1 runway (03/21), with the longest at 5,598 feet.
Weather Profile
Based on 13,833 weather observations, KAJZ experiences excellent VFR conditions 95.7% of the time, making it one of the more weather-reliable airports in its region.
Wind Patterns & Runway Selection
Prevailing winds at KAJZ come from the NE (45°) with an average speed of 5.8 knots and recorded gusts up to 29 knots. Calm wind conditions are common (34.8% of observations), allowing flexible runway selection. Runway 03/21 offers the lowest average crosswind component at 2.9 knots, making it the preferred choice in typical wind conditions.
Seasonal Considerations
The best months for VFR operations are November, April, March, when clear skies are most prevalent. Temperatures at the field range from -13°C (9°F) to 35°C (95°F), averaging 8.5°C (47°F). Altimeter settings typically range from 29.48 to 30.73 inHg (998-1041 hPa).
